Advanced Cryptocurrency BLS Signatures: Insights from Bitcoin’s Aggregation Techniques

Cryptographic signatures play a pivotal role in ensuring the security and authenticity of transactions within the cryptocurrency space. One cryptographic technique that has gained prominence in recent years is Boneh-Lynn-Shacham (BLS) signatures. This article aims to delve into the world of BLS signatures, particularly in the context of Bitcoin, and explore how aggregation techniques are revolutionizing the blockchain landscape. While discussing the efficiency of BLS signatures in Bitcoin’s transaction aggregation, it’s worth noting that platforms like Qumas AI leverage similar advanced cryptographic techniques to enhance the security and efficiency of their online trading operations.

The Significance of Cryptographic Signatures in Cryptocurrency

Cryptocurrencies rely on digital signatures to validate transactions and ensure that only authorized parties can initiate and confirm transfers of digital assets. Without robust cryptographic signatures, the integrity of blockchain networks would be compromised, leading to potential fraud and double-spending issues.

Brief Overview of BLS Signatures

BLS signatures are a type of digital signature scheme based on the BLS cryptography framework, introduced by Dan Boneh, Ben Lynn, and Hovav Shacham in 2004. Unlike the more traditional Elliptic Curve Digital Signature Algorithm (ECDSA), BLS signatures offer distinct advantages in terms of efficiency and scalability.

The Importance of Aggregation Techniques in Bitcoin

Bitcoin, the pioneer of blockchain technology, has been grappling with scalability issues for years. As the network’s popularity grows, the need for more efficient cryptographic methods becomes increasingly evident. This is where BLS signatures and aggregation techniques come into play.

Purpose and Scope of the Article

This article aims to provide an in-depth exploration of BLS signatures, their applications in cryptocurrency, and how Bitcoin is utilizing aggregation techniques to address scalability and privacy challenges. We will also discuss the implications of these advancements and the potential future developments in the world of digital finance.

Understanding BLS Signatures

What Are BLS Signatures?

At its core, BLS cryptography is a mathematical framework that enables efficient and secure digital signatures. Unlike ECDSA, which relies on elliptic curves, BLS signatures use pairing-based cryptography, resulting in smaller signature sizes and faster verification.

Basics of BLS Cryptography

BLS signatures leverage mathematical pairings between points on elliptic curves, making them highly resistant to quantum attacks. This property is critical for long-term security in the age of quantum computing.

How BLS Signatures Differ from ECDSA

ECDSA signatures involve multiple steps and large signature sizes, whereas BLS signatures offer a more streamlined process and significantly reduced signature size, making them more efficient for blockchain applications.

Applications of BLS Signatures in Cryptocurrency

Improving Scalability

One of the most pressing challenges facing blockchain networks like Bitcoin is scalability. As the number of transactions increases, so does the computational burden. BLS signatures offer a potential solution by reducing the size of signatures and enabling faster transaction processing.

Enhancing Privacy

Privacy is a growing concern in the cryptocurrency space. BLS signatures can be applied to confidential transactions, allowing for increased privacy without compromising on security. This is especially important in light of regulatory developments.

Reducing Transaction Size

Smaller signature sizes mean smaller transaction sizes, which can lead to reduced fees and more efficient use of blockchain resources. BLS signatures contribute to the optimization of blockchain data storage.

The Need for Aggregation in Cryptocurrency

Challenges of Scalability in Blockchain Networks

Scalability issues in blockchain networks arise from the growing demand for processing transactions. Bitcoin, in particular, faces limitations in terms of transaction throughput, making it crucial to find innovative solutions.

Benefits of Aggregation Techniques

Aggregation techniques involve combining multiple signatures into a single, more compact signature. This process offers several advantages, including reduced computational overhead, improved efficiency, and enhanced network scalability.

Role of BLS Signatures in Aggregation

BLS signatures are particularly well-suited for aggregation due to their inherent properties. They allow multiple signatures to be aggregated into a single signature, resulting in reduced blockchain bloat and more efficient use of network resources.

Bitcoin’s Aggregation Techniques

Introduction to Bitcoin’s Use of BLS Signatures

Bitcoin’s adoption of BLS signatures is a significant step toward addressing scalability challenges. Let’s explore how Bitcoin incorporates BLS signatures and aggregation techniques into its ecosystem.

Multi-Signature Aggregation

Advantages of Multi-Signature Schemes

Multi-signature transactions involve multiple parties signing a transaction, adding an extra layer of security. BLS signatures enable efficient aggregation of these multiple signatures into a single, compact signature.

Combining Multiple Signatures into One

Bitcoin can aggregate multiple signatures from different parties into a single BLS signature, reducing the size of multi-signature transactions and improving the network’s efficiency.

Threshold Signatures

Distributing Signing Authority

Threshold signatures distribute signing authority among multiple parties, ensuring that no single entity has full control. BLS signatures can be used to aggregate threshold signatures, enhancing security and reducing the risk of single points of failure.

Achieving Robust Security

Threshold signatures, when combined with BLS aggregation, provide robust security measures, making it difficult for adversaries to compromise the network’s integrity.

Signature Aggregation in Taproot

How Taproot Ushers in a New Era for Bitcoin

The implementation of Taproot, a proposed upgrade for Bitcoin, introduces significant changes to the network’s scripting system. BLS signatures and aggregation play a vital role in Taproot’s functionality.

Combining Schnorr Signatures and BLS Aggregation

Taproot combines Schnorr signatures with BLS aggregation to improve the privacy and efficiency of Bitcoin transactions. This combination allows for more complex smart contracts while maintaining compact transaction sizes.

Privacy Enhancements through BLS Aggregation

Reducing On-Chain Footprint

Bitcoin’s transparency is a double-edged sword. While it ensures trust and auditability, it also exposes transaction details to the public. BLS aggregation can mitigate this by reducing the on-chain footprint of transactions.

Enhancing Confidential Transactions

Confidential transactions, which hide transaction amounts, benefit from BLS aggregation by reducing the size of range proofs and improving the overall privacy of the Bitcoin network.

Implications for Anonymity in Bitcoin

Improved privacy through BLS aggregation may lead to enhanced anonymity for Bitcoin users, as their transaction history becomes less transparent. However, the balance between privacy and regulatory compliance remains a challenge.

Challenges and Limitations

Potential Attack Vectors

While BLS signatures and aggregation techniques offer many benefits, they are not without vulnerabilities. Potential attack vectors, such as rogue key attacks and fault attacks, must be considered and mitigated.

Adoption and Compatibility Issues

The adoption of BLS signatures and aggregation techniques requires network-wide consensus and software upgrades. Ensuring backward compatibility and addressing resistance to change are significant challenges.

Regulatory and Compliance Concerns

Enhanced privacy features may raise concerns among regulators, as they could potentially facilitate illegal activities. Striking a balance between privacy and compliance is a delicate matter that the cryptocurrency community must navigate.

The Future of BLS Signatures and Aggregation in Cryptocurrency

Ongoing Research and Developments

The field of BLS signatures and aggregation is dynamic, with ongoing research aimed at addressing challenges and optimizing these cryptographic techniques for various blockchain platforms.

Adoption Trends in the Cryptocurrency Industry

The adoption of BLS signatures and aggregation techniques is likely to expand as the cryptocurrency industry matures and seeks solutions to its scalability and privacy concerns.

Potential Impact on the Broader Financial Ecosystem

The efficient use of BLS signatures and aggregation techniques in cryptocurrency could pave the way for broader applications in the traditional financial sector, potentially reshaping the future of finance.

Conclusion

In summary, BLS signatures and aggregation techniques represent a significant leap forward in addressing the scalability and privacy challenges faced by cryptocurrency networks, with Bitcoin at the forefront of this innovation. As the cryptocurrency landscape continues to evolve, these cryptographic advancements have the potential to redefine how digital assets are transacted and secured, offering a promising future for blockchain technology and its applications in the broader financial ecosystem. Further research, development, and careful consideration of regulatory implications will be key to harnessing the full potential of BLS signatures and aggregation techniques.